Understanding Peer-to-Peer Lending: A Beginner’s Guide
Peer-to-peer lending is a financial innovation that allows individuals to lend and borrow money directly, cutting out traditional banking intermediaries. In this FAQ section, we’ll address common questions about peer-to-peer lending and how it works.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is peer-to-peer lending, and how does it work?
Peer-to-peer lending is a platform where individuals lend money to others, known as borrowers, in exchange for interest. This process is facilitated by a digital platform that connects lenders with borrowers, eliminating the need for traditional banking institutions. Lenders can choose to lend to multiple borrowers, diversifying their portfolio and reducing risk.
Is peer-to-peer lending safe, and what are the risks involved?
Peer-to-peer lending carries risks, including the possibility of borrowers defaulting on their loans. To mitigate this risk, lenders can choose to lend to multiple borrowers, spreading their investment across different loans. Additionally, many peer-to-peer lending platforms offer features such as credit scoring and loan grading to help lenders make informed decisions.

What are the benefits of peer-to-peer lending compared to traditional banking?
Peer-to-peer lending offers several benefits compared to traditional banking, including higher returns on investment and lower fees. Additionally, peer-to-peer lending platforms often provide more flexible lending options and faster access to funds. However, it’s essential to carefully evaluate the risks and rewards before investing in peer-to-peer lending.
How do I choose the right peer-to-peer lending platform for my needs?
To choose the right peer-to-peer lending platform, consider factors such as interest rates, fees, loan grades, and credit scoring. Look for platforms that are transparent about their operations, offer robust security measures, and have a strong track record of borrower repayment. You may also want to read reviews and ask for recommendations from friends or family members who have experience with peer-to-peer lending.
